Customizable TUI Pomodoro timer with ASCII art, progress bar, desktop notifications, and productivity statistics.
git clone https://github.com/Bahaaio/pomo.gitBahaaio/pomoA simple, customizable Pomodoro timer for your terminal, built with Bubble Tea.
Track your productivity with pomo stats:
Heatmap icons require a Nerd Font
pomo sends native desktop notifications when sessions complete
Linux (GNOME)
Windows
Note: Actual notification appearance varies by operating system and desktop environment

Work sessions:
pomo # work session pomo 30m # 30m work session pomo 45m 15m # 45m work with 15m break pomo -t "write report" # work session with custom title (or --title)
Break sessions:
pomo break # break session pomo break 10m # 10m break session
View statistics:
pomo stats # View your productivity stats

pomo looks for its config file in the following order:
pomo.yaml (highest priority)~/.config/pomo/pomo.yaml%APPDATA%\pomo\pomo.yamlExample pomo.yaml:
# action to take after session completion
# options: "ask" | "start" | "quit"
onSessionEnd: "ask"
asciiArt:
# use ASCII art for timer display
enabled: true
# available fonts: "mono12" | "rebel" | "ansi" | "ansiShadow"
# default: mono12
font: ansiShadow
# color of the ASCII art timer
# hex color or "none"
color: "#5A56E0"
work:
duration: 25m
title: work session
# cross-platform notifications
notification:
enabled: true
urgent: true # persistent notification with alert sound (platform-dependent)
title: work finished 🎉
message: time to take a break
icon: ~/my/icon.png
break:
duration: 5m
# will run after the session ends
then:
- [spd-say, "Back to work!"]
longBreak:
# enable long break after a certain number of work sessions
enabled: true
# number of work sessions before long break
after: 4
# long break duration
duration: 15m
Check out pomo.yaml for a full example with all options.
You can play sounds when sessions complete by running commands in the then section.
work:
then:
- [paplay, ~/sounds/work-done.mp3] # Linux
# - [afplay, ~/sounds/work-done.mp3] # macOS
# - [powershell, start, work-done.mp3] # Windows
Commands run with a 5 second timeout and are automatically cancelled when starting the next session.
